Bellefontaine, Ohio — Benjamin Logan High School’s instrumental music program participated in the Ohio Music Education Association (OMEA) Solo & Ensemble Adjudicated Events held this past the weekend, continuing a tradition of strong performances.
Student musicians earned 14 Superior ratings (1s) and four Excellent ratings (2s).
OMEA adjudicates solos and ensembles using a five-point rating scale, with 1 representing the highest possible distinction.
“I’m proud of our students for the work they put into preparing for Solo & Ensemble,” said Myles Bowers, Benjamin Logan High School Instrumental Music Director. “Their focus, effort, and musicianship were evident throughout the weekend.”
